Understanding water bottling machine price requires a comprehensive look at what these systems offer to businesses in the beverage industry. A water bottling machine represents a significant investment for companies ranging from small startups to large-scale manufacturing operations. The water bottling machine price typically reflects the sophistication of automation, production capacity, and technological integration built into the system. These machines perform essential functions including bottle rinsing, filling, capping, labeling, and packaging in a streamlined production line. Modern water bottling equipment incorporates advanced PLC control systems that manage every stage of the bottling process with precision. The technological features embedded in contemporary machines include automatic bottle feeding mechanisms, precise volumetric filling systems, sterile processing chambers, and quality inspection modules. When evaluating water bottling machine price, buyers must consider the machine's ability to handle various bottle sizes, materials like PET or glass, and production speeds measured in bottles per hour. Applications span across multiple sectors including mineral water production, purified drinking water packaging, flavored water bottling, and even carbonated beverage filling. The price spectrum varies considerably based on capacity, with small semi-automatic units serving boutique operations at lower price points, while fully automated high-speed lines command premium investments. Essential components affecting water bottling machine price include stainless steel construction for hygiene compliance, servo motor systems for accuracy, touch-screen interfaces for operator convenience, and integration capabilities with upstream purification systems and downstream packaging equipment. Energy efficiency has become a crucial factor, with modern machines designed to minimize power consumption and water waste during the rinsing cycle. The return on investment depends heavily on production volume requirements, labor cost savings through automation, and the reduction of product waste through precise filling technology. When assessing water bottling machine price, businesses should factor in installation costs, operator training, maintenance requirements, and the availability of technical support from manufacturers.

Investing in the right water bottling machine price point delivers tangible benefits that directly impact your bottom line and operational efficiency. First and foremost, automation reduces labor costs significantly by eliminating the need for multiple workers to manually fill, cap, and label bottles. A single operator can monitor an entire production line, allowing you to reallocate human resources to other critical business areas. The consistency provided by automated systems ensures every bottle contains the exact same volume of water, which protects your brand reputation and ensures compliance with regulatory standards. This precision filling technology minimizes product waste, meaning you get more filled bottles from every batch of purified water, directly improving your profit margins. When you choose an appropriate water bottling machine price range for your business scale, you gain the flexibility to increase production as demand grows without proportionally increasing your workforce. Modern machines operate at speeds that would be impossible to achieve manually, with entry-level systems producing hundreds of bottles per hour and industrial-grade equipment reaching thousands of units hourly. The hygienic benefits cannot be overstated, as these machines feature stainless steel construction and automated cleaning cycles that maintain sanitary conditions throughout production, reducing contamination risks that could lead to costly product recalls. The water bottling machine price includes sophisticated quality control features like automatic reject systems that identify and remove improperly filled or capped bottles before they reach consumers. This built-in quality assurance protects your brand and reduces customer complaints. Energy efficiency built into modern designs translates to lower utility bills over the equipment's lifespan, making the initial water bottling machine price more justifiable when calculating total cost of ownership. The professional appearance of machine-filled bottles with consistent labels and caps enhances product presentation on retail shelves, helping your brand compete effectively against established competitors. Maintenance requirements for quality machines remain manageable, with accessible components and clear diagnostic systems that minimize downtime. The scalability factor means you can start with a machine suited to your current production needs and upgrade components or add modules as your business expands, protecting your initial investment. Technical support from reputable manufacturers ensures you maximize uptime and productivity, making the water bottling machine price a true investment rather than merely an expense. The data collection capabilities of computerized systems provide valuable production metrics that help you optimize operations, identify bottlenecks, and make informed decisions about expansion timing.

Production Capacity Matched to Business Scale Determines Optimal Investment

One of the most critical factors influencing water bottling machine price is the production capacity measured in bottles per hour, and understanding this relationship helps businesses make smart purchasing decisions that align with their current needs and growth projections. Entry-level semi-automatic machines priced at the lower end of the spectrum typically produce between 500 to 1200 bottles per hour, making them ideal for startup operations, regional brands, or specialty water products targeting niche markets. These systems require some manual intervention for bottle loading or cap placement but still provide substantial efficiency improvements over completely manual operations. The water bottling machine price increases proportionally as you move into mid-range automatic systems capable of producing 2000 to 6000 bottles hourly, which suits established regional distributors or growing brands expanding their market presence. These machines feature fully automated processes from bottle feeding through final packaging, with integrated rinsing, filling, and capping functions operating in synchronized harmony. At the premium end, high-speed production lines justify their water bottling machine price by delivering 10000 to 24000 bottles per hour or more, serving large-scale manufacturers supplying national or international markets. The beauty of this tiered pricing structure lies in accessibility, allowing businesses at every stage to find equipment matching their production requirements without overpaying for unnecessary capacity or underinvesting in equipment that creates production bottlenecks. When evaluating water bottling machine price against capacity, calculate your current daily production needs and project growth over the next three to five years, ensuring the machine you select can accommodate expansion without requiring complete replacement. Consider that operating a machine below fifty percent capacity wastes the investment, while consistently running at maximum capacity leaves no room for increased orders or equipment maintenance downtime. The modularity of many modern systems allows businesses to purchase a base configuration at a reasonable water bottling machine price and add components like additional filling heads, faster conveyors, or automated packaging modules as production demands increase, protecting the initial investment while enabling scalable growth that matches revenue increases with capital expenditures appropriately timed for cash flow management.
Advanced Automation Technology Reduces Operating Costs and Improves Product Quality

The technological sophistication embedded in modern equipment significantly influences water bottling machine price, yet these advanced features deliver operational savings that quickly offset the initial investment through reduced labor requirements, minimized waste, and enhanced product consistency. Programmable logic controllers serve as the intelligent brain of contemporary bottling systems, coordinating dozens of sensors, valves, motors, and conveyors to maintain perfect synchronization throughout the production process. These computer systems allow operators to store multiple production recipes for different bottle sizes or product types, switching between configurations with simple touchscreen commands rather than manual mechanical adjustments that consumed hours in older equipment generations. The water bottling machine price reflects these control systems, but the efficiency gains prove substantial when you consider that recipe changes taking five minutes instead of two hours mean more productive time and faster responses to market demands. Servo motor technology provides precise control over filling volumes, ensuring each bottle contains exactly the specified amount within tolerances measured in milliliters, which protects against underfilling violations that could trigger regulatory penalties while eliminating overfilling waste that erodes profit margins bottle by bottle. Automatic inspection systems using cameras or sensors verify cap placement, label positioning, and fill levels, immediately rejecting defective units before they enter distribution channels, which safeguards brand reputation far more effectively than manual quality checks that suffer from human fatigue and inconsistency. The water bottling machine price encompasses these quality assurance technologies that function as tireless guardians of product standards. Sanitary design features including CIP systems for cleaning in place allow automated washing cycles that sanitize all product-contact surfaces without disassembly, reducing contamination risks while cutting cleaning time from hours to minutes and eliminating the specialized labor previously required for equipment breakdown and sanitization. Modern human-machine interfaces with color touchscreens display real-time production data, maintenance alerts, and diagnostic information in intuitive formats that reduce training requirements for operators and enable faster troubleshooting when issues arise, minimizing costly downtime. The integration capabilities built into systems at every water bottling machine price point allow seamless connection with upstream water treatment equipment and downstream packaging machinery, creating efficient production flows that eliminate manual transfer bottlenecks while providing comprehensive data tracking from raw water input through finished product palletization for complete traceability and process optimization.
Durable Construction and Reliable Components Ensure Long-Term Value Beyond Initial Purchase Price

While water bottling machine price represents a significant upfront investment, the quality of materials and components determines the true cost of ownership over the equipment's operational lifespan, making durability and reliability essential considerations that ultimately prove more important than the initial purchase price alone. Food-grade stainless steel construction, typically 304 or 316 grade, forms the foundation of quality bottling equipment, providing corrosion resistance essential for equipment constantly exposed to water and cleaning chemicals while meeting strict hygiene standards required by food safety regulations worldwide. The water bottling machine price necessarily includes these premium materials, but their longevity means the equipment maintains structural integrity and sanitary properties for decades rather than requiring replacement after just a few years of service. High-quality pneumatic components from established manufacturers ensure reliable operation of valves, cylinders, and actuators that cycle millions of times throughout the machine's lifetime, with proper maintenance schedules extending component life and preventing unexpected failures during production runs. The bearing systems, conveyor chains, and mechanical drives built into machines at appropriate water bottling machine price points use industrial-grade components designed for continuous operation rather than consumer-grade parts that fail prematurely under production demands. Electrical components including motors, drives, and control panels featuring recognized brands provide assurance of availability for replacement parts and technical support, avoiding the nightmare scenario of obsolete components that render an entire machine inoperable because a single proprietary part becomes unavailable. Manufacturer reputation directly correlates with water bottling machine price, as established companies invest in engineering, quality control, and after-sales support infrastructure that protects buyer investments through readily available technical assistance, spare parts inventory, and sometimes on-site service capabilities. The warranty coverage accompanying your purchase reflects manufacturer confidence in their equipment, with comprehensive warranties covering major components for extended periods providing peace of mind and financial protection against defects or premature failures. Beyond the warranty period, maintenance requirements and parts availability determine ongoing operational costs, making machines with accessible components, clear maintenance documentation, and common replacement parts more economical over time despite potentially higher water bottling machine price initially. The resale value of quality equipment remains substantial, as well-maintained machines from reputable manufacturers find ready buyers in secondary markets, effectively reducing your net equipment cost when you eventually upgrade to higher capacity systems. Energy consumption varies significantly between efficient modern designs and older technology, with the electricity costs over a machine's decade-plus operational life potentially exceeding the original water bottling machine price, making energy-efficient models with variable frequency drives and optimized pneumatic systems wise investments that reduce operating expenses month after month.
